Customer Review: You still have to clean the parts first...
Summary: 5 Stars

Which I don't think is a problem, but some people I've talked to and some reviews make it seem like you can just throw the dirty pump parts in and they come out clean. Steam doesn't clean, it just sterilizes. So you do have to first wash with soap and water (or Medela's Quick Clean wipes) and then these bags are very handy for sterilizing. I use these at work because I use two sets of pump parts several times a day and while I do wash them with soap and water, I don't do as good of a job as I would at home. By steam-sterilizing the parts once a day, I feel better at my sub-par washing and the bag folds up nicely in my pump bag to take along. A great product...though I'm a little curious as to what happens after 20 uses. Do they self destruct? Will they start leaching chemicals out? They're just a heavy duty plastic bag and don't seem like they'll fall apart that fast. I wish the manufacturer said WHY not to use them more than 20 times, as I'd be more likely to not just use one until it falls apart.

Customer Review: You Still Need to Wash Parts!! Read the Directions First!!
Summary: 2 Stars

If you are considering these Medala Micro-Steam Bags, PLEASE READ THIS REVIEW - you will still need to disassemble and wash all parts with warm soapy water BEFORE you put the parts in the bag and steam-clean them in the microwave. I have read several reviews - ones on this site and reviews on other sites - that state that these bags are great time savers because all you have to do is rinse the parts, stick them in the bag, and nuke them for a few minutes. My mistake was that I purchased these bags off of the rave reviews of other moms and didn't read the directions closely. A month after using them, I happened to glance at the directions printed on the bags and saw that step #1 was to disassemble and wash all parts in warm, soapy water. So while I was happily throwing my rinsed off bottles and pump parts in the nuker to save time, I was actually skipping a really important sanitizing step. Now, I'm just back to using soap and the bottle brush to clean everything. So yes, if you're looking to sterilize your bottles/pump parts once in a while, these bags can work for you, but if you're thinking of using them on a daily basis, they are not worth the money.
